Usually he starts a puzzle by mapping out a symmetrical pattern of black and white squares, then filling in the words. Aiming for a record: fewest black squares in a puzzle, or most stacked 15-letter words or fewest entries in a 15-by-15 grid (the record low is 54 words; Quigley's best is 64).
